Analysis

In 2023, lifespan inequality: gini coefficient by sex in Morocco stood at 0.1007.

The figure is up 0.7% on the previous year and down 13.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, lifespan inequality: gini coefficient by sex in Morocco peaked at 0.4361 in 1950 and was at its lowest, 0.1, in 2022.

Morocco ranks 126th of 236 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 74 years of available data.
